    This operating manual contains important information you require to start up and run your LCD monitor. A screen controller with VGA interface is required to control the SCENICVIEW A17-2A / A19-2ALCD monitor. The monitor processes the data supplied to it by the screen controller. The screen controller/the associated driver software is responsible for setting the modes (resolution and refresh rate).

    Notes on power management If your computer is equipped with power management, the monitor can support this function fully. Here the monitor does not distinguish between the individual energy-saving modes of the computer (standby mode, suspend mode and OFF mode), as it is capable of immediately switching into the mode with the highest energy-saving effect.

  • Page 23 Adjusting the brightness and contrast Calling the setting window Brightness Setting the brightness of the display With this function you change the brightness of the background lighting. Setting the contrast of the display Contrast With this function you modify the contrast of bright colour tones. If the contrast is set too high, bright surfaces can no longer be distinguished from very bright surfaces.
  • Page 24 Setting colour temperature and colours Calling the setting window Selecting the colour temperature The "warmth" of the screen colours is set using the colour temperature. The colour temperature is measured in K (= Kelvin). You can select from 6500 K , 9300 K , Customer Colour and sRGB .

    Notes regarding the DIN EN ISO 13406-2 standard Permanently unlit or lit pixels The standard of production techniques today cannot guarantee an absolutely fault-free screen display. A few isolated constant lit or unlit pixels (picture elements) may be present. The maximum permitted number of pixels faults is stipulated in the stringent international standard ISO 13406-2 (Class II).

    VESA-DDC-compatible VGA interface Your monitor is equipped with a VESA-DDC-compatible VGA interface. VESA-DDC (Video Electronics Standard Association, Display Data Channel) is used as the communications interface between the monitor and the computer. If your computer is equipped with a VESA-DDC-compatible VGA interface, it can automatically read the data for ensuring optimum operation from your monitor and select the appropriate settings.
